You (the coachee) are the critical component in the coaching process. You are responsible for your achievements and success. This is a key distinction from the consulting process, in which the hired consultant provides a solution and action plan and takes ownership for driving results. The coaching process is very different. In the coaching process, you are the driver of your success. The coach partners with you to facilitate the actualization of goals. Where does my coaching take place?

Coaching can be done in person or on the phone. The typical client coaches by telephone so they can connect anytime and anywhere. The advantages of the telephone are:

·         Time: Blocking off an hour for a phone call is easier than blocking off an hour for an
       appointment that requires travel. Schedules are full and time-management demands are
       high.
·         Confidentiality: The ability to communicate with me from the privacy of your home or office
        ensures that you are in a place that promotes the honesty and openness required to ensure
        success.
·         Location: We live in a mobile world, and many of us travel for work. Coaching need not stop
        because you travel or move. We can connect anytime and anywhere.
